Andris Trubee (d.1758) immigrated from Holland to Boston, Massachusetts in about 1699/1700. He married twice, and moved to Fairfield, Connecticut. Descendants and relatives lived in New England, New York and elsewhere. Includes some ancestors in England, The Netherlands and elsewhere.
Includes Adams, Booth, Curtiss, Doan, Garlick, Knapp, Stapples, Turney and related families.

Walter Merryman was kidnapped in an Irish port in 1700 and brought to Boston, Massachusetts, where he was indentured to a shipbuilder in Portland, Maine. He married Elizabeth Potter and settled in Harpswell, Maine. Descendants and relatives lived in Maine, New Hampshire, Connecticut, New York, Pennsylvania, Idaho and elsewhere.

Traces the Curtiss line of Trueman Curtiss (1800-1876) and his brother Amos Hickok Curtiss (1806-1880) back to a John Curtiss of Essex Co., England (ca. 1475). Includes descendants of Trueman and Amos and other relatives. Early ancestors settled in Connecticut.

Stephen Gates (ca.1600-1662) married Anne Veare Hill in 1628, and they immigrated from England to Hingham, Massachusetts in 1638. He died in Cambridge, Massachusetts. Descendants lived in Massachusetts, New York, Pennsylvania, Florida, the midwest, California and elsewhere.

John and Elizabeth Larr moved from Pennsylvania to Ohio before 1846, to Clay County, Kansas in the 1870s, and to land near Custer, Michigan (although their children remained chiefly in Kansas) before 1890. Descendants lived in Kansas, Oklahoma, Maryland and elsewhere.

Thomas Prudden was born in 1487 in England to Thomas and Margaret Prudden. He married Ellen and they had at least one son. He was buried in 1558/1559. Two of his second great-grandchildren, James and Peter Prudden, immigrated to Connecticut before 1640. Descendants lived in England, Connecticut, Vermont, New York, Illinois, Iowa, Missouri, Idaho, and elsewhere.

Thomas Robert Burt Daniel (1815-1887), son of John Daniel (b.ca.1785) and grandson of Joseph Ruben Daniel (b.ca.1760), immigrated from England to Adelaide, South Australia in 1837 on the ship "John Renwick." Two of his sisters and at least one of his brothers also immigrated (the two sisters in 1847 and 1850). Descendants lived in South Australia and elsewhere.
